Sep 27, 2005 the world wind project began in 2002 at nasa learning technologies, a lab whose purpose is to develop educational software for delivering nasa data. Follow these instructions to download, run, and deploy an application using worldwind. This guide shows how to create a wms server using apache, mapserver and imagery data sets curated by nasa. Flickering annotations in worldwind java stack overflow. Most of worldwinds components are defined by interfaces. The combination of blue marble and other systems like landsat 7 a photo collection in which each pixel represents 15 real meters offers stunning effects.
Nasa worldwind software development kits sdks for geospatial 3d virtual globe visualization via openglwebgl on android, java and. Visual studio 2008 upgrade from visual studio 2005. Nasa world wind is a graphically rich 3d virtual globe for use on desktop computers running windows. Develop a worldclass world wind application for personal computers. World wind is licensed under the nasa open source agreement, with optional registration requested if you are looking for the java version of world wind please see the nasa world wind java sdk page. Setup instructions, developers guides, api documentation and more are available at worldwind. There is one other thing you should be aware of, the cache location depends on the user permissions.
Nasa world wind is a graphically rich 3d earth visualization software. To cause a stereo device to be selected and used, specify the java vm property gov. It also initiates a portal that gathers into one place all information relative to understanding and using world wind and its api. How to build a worldwind web app nasa worldwind workshop. Nasa first released worldwind in 2003, and made it available to the open source community a year later. Full copy of the latest nasa worldwind software version 1. The java urlconnection class does not follow the redirect protocol. This archived world wind java release has been migrated to github from the world wind subversion server. This guide shows how to create a wms server on a local vm using apache, mapserver and elevation data sets curated by nasa. Now we will add some more layers to the web app and explore a few of the worldwind. We are in the read more january 15, 2020 new releases for the worldwind java and web platforms are ready, however they are being delayed due to new nasa software release processes.
Zoom in to any place on earth via nasa s satellites. This github repository contains the library source, examples and tutorials. Primary data sources come from nasa, and terraserverusa of microsoft. Web worldwind is a free, opensource virtual globe for web pages. After spending time on research and following the tutorials recommendations, im still not able to start my project using nasa world wind sdk 2 in netbeans 8 on a 32bit windows 7 machine. This paper will also address how the world wind project faces numerous challenges forward. Set this to false when this window is sharing context with other windows and is likely to be reparented. To start viewing messages, select the forum that you want to visit from the selection below. Worldwind earth explorer, worldwindjs, worldwind java and. A value of true indicates that the gpu resource cache this window is using should be cleared when its init method is called, typically when reparented. A stereo capable scenecontroller such as stereoscenecontroller must also be specified in the worldwind configuration.
It uses the emxsys worldwindjs library to display a 3d globe with terrain and imagery as well as 2d maps. Problem connecting to server the nasa world wind forum. According to project spokesman randy kim, the original core was intended to run on linux and windows using opengl. Realtime 3d graphics are driven by directx allowing a wide base of compatibility with accelerated video hardware. World wind, an open source 3d interactive world viewer, was created by nasas learning technologies project, and released in mid2004. Download nasa world wind for windows now from softonic. At this stage you have a functioning globe in the web app that responds to mouse and touch input. The worldwind explorer is a geospatial web app for visualizing the earth. Worldwindjs releases can be downloaded from github or from npm. This tutorial shows you how to build a worldwind web app using bootstrap and knockout.
The api documentation will be made available later. The default configuration specifies a stereocapable controller. Wwj is not a standalone application but rather, a software development kit sdk that can be used to build custom applications. With this sdk, developers can embed world wind technology in their own applications. Compatibility with this software may vary, but will generally run fine under microsoft windows 10, windows 8, windows 8. How to setup a nasa worldwind imagery server introduction.
This github organizations default community health files. Layer properties that we can set via the options object, such as. Sep 11, 2016 nasa world wind complete setup free download for windows. This can be changed by setting the java property gov. Nasa worldwind java sdk worldwind java wwj is an free, opensource geographic information system gis from nasa that provides highresolution imagery of the world and a framework for displaying that information including capabilities for displaying additional, overlayed information. It combines nasa imagery generated from satellites that have produced blue marble, landsat 7, srtm, modis and more. World wind includes the wellknown blue marble system, an spectacular realcolour 3d image of the earth. Worldwindowglautodrawable nasa worldwind github pages. World wind is a collaborative effort between nasa intelligent system division, the usra research institute for advanced computer science riacs, and the open source community. Net technical introduction nasa has created a very powerful java sdk, called world wind, for the visualization of geographical data. We understand that quite a few of you are eager to receive these new releases and we appreciate your patience. Worldwind is an sdk software development kit that software engineers can use to build their own applications. Objects implementing a particular interface may be used wherever that interface is called for. Written in javascript, web worldwind enables web page and application builders to quickly create interactive visualizations of geographic information on an interactive 3d globe or 2d map.
Here is a quick update on our progress with the latest worldwind release which is now. Specifies whether to reinitialize the gpu resource cache when this window is reinitialized. In fact, the investment we are making in the hardening of worldwinds software release artifacts is a testament to nasas plans for. This release of world wind operates on all platforms world wind has historically supported. Best, andre windows insider mvp mvp windows and devices for it twitteradacosta. Ive also tried to run worldwind under java 10 and had to run back to java version 1. The worldwindjs project is available on github and releases are available on npm.
Nasa worldwind 3d earth visualization software for. The layer holding the rotation line and perhaps other affordances. Its strange because it only seems to affect surface shapes and it is only happening on this hardware this seems to run as expected on windows. World wind provides several globeobjects representing earth, mars and the earths moon, and provides basic implementations of model, scenecontrollerand view. Worldwindjs is a dropin replacement for the nasa web worldwind library. To run a worldwind demo application, visit the demos page. As of 2017, a webbased version of worldwind is available online. Additionally, some scammers may try to identify themselves as a microsoft mvp. An open source virtual globe rendering engine for 3d. Race uses racelayers to map its bus channels to worldwind layers. Download the latest release from the worldwind github releases. Most of worldwind s components are defined by interfaces.
You may want to check out more software, such as world wind geospatial onestop portal, world wind java surface shapes or world wind on screen controls, which might be related to nasa world wind. It displays the sunrise and sunset times and solar angles for any point on the earth. Nasa world wind provides the ideal environment for scientific data, their analysis, visual representation and interaction with users, in a single platform, which can be deployed both as a java desktop application. The nasa worldwind java sdk wwj is for building crossplatform 3d. Addons allow you to view trails and other areas of interest.
Net technology for rapid development and to easily access open standards such as xml, wms, and other graphics standards. Instructions, tutorials, and examples are available on the projects home page. The biggest problem was compatibility with the jogl implementation as i remember. The technology offers a 3d graphics user experience with seamless, integrated access to a variety of online data sources via openstandards. It was first developed by nasa in 2003 for use on personal computers and then further developed in concert with the open source community since 2004. The source code links below reference the initial commit to github and are incorrect. This paper covers the nasa world wind open source project as a soft realtime system. Nasa will continue to release updates to the worldwind sdks, and will continue to make the worldwind servers accessible for all users. While a racelayer is a gui object that executes within the user interface thread, it has an associated racelayeractor which is responsible for data acquisition by means of channel subscription.
It creates a globe with a background layer the globe. Post moved by the moderator to the appropriate forum category. How to setup a nasa worldwind elevation server introduction. In fact, the investment we are making in the hardening of worldwinds software release artifacts is a testament to nasa s plans for worldwind support in the future. February 26, 2020 dear worldwind community, here is a quick update on our progress with the latest worldwind release which is now just a few weeks away. If this is your first visit, be sure to check out the faq by clicking the link above. Visit nasa world wind site and download nasa world wind latest version. The world wind team uses macs for development, and with nasa being a government agency they must support common distribution criteria, which means they must run on red hat enterprise linux, windows and solaris, but that is phasing out and generally just used in data centers. World wind, an open source 3d interactive world viewer, was created by nasa s learning technologies project, and released in mid2004. Plugins allow you to use extra features not provided with world wind. Nasa will continue to release updates to the worldwind sdks, and will. Nasa world wind is an open source applicationprogramming interface for developing geographic information systems based on a virtual globe rendering engine representing a planet. It is an open source, open standards, and crossplatform java sdk that allows you to quickly create powerful guis to visualize and manipulate gis data.
Nasa world wind is an intuitive software application supporting the interactive exploration of a variety of data presented within a geospatial context. The nasa worldwind javascript sdk webww includes the library and examples for creating geobrowser web applications and. Modifications in design and implementation are done daily to improve upon both the performance capabilities as well as feature and cache pack additions. You will build a featurerich, responsive, customizable web app ready to. Nasa worldwind is an opensource released under the nosa license and the apache 2. The default worldwind configuration document is configworldwind.
Reverseiterator accessorylayer variable in class gov. Save money over other 3d earth visualization software. Worldwind community fork the nasa world wind forum. The nasa guys made it clear that worldwind is an opensource project, but is closed development. This wms server serves as a model for a production mapserver instance to be deployed on an a network. Learn how to build web apps with nasa s 3d virtual globe technology. Rest assured that nasa is committed to continued support of worldwind. The nasa worldwind server kit wwsk is an open source java project that assembles geoserver for easy distribution and implementation.
Nasa world wind is an open source project funded by the national aeronautics and space administration nasa and the national science foundation nsf that allows visually rich, interactive exploratory movement around the earth and its surface, moon.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Worldwindjs is a community maintained fork of the webworldwind virtual globe sdk from nasa an interactive 3d globe library featuring maps, imagery and. World wind has been tested on nvidia, atiamd, and intel platforms using windows, macos 10. How to setup a nasa worldwind elevation server github. This is complete offline one click standalone setup of nasa world wind which is compatible with both 32 bit and 64 bit operating systems. The globe class encapsulates the worldwindow and contains the application logic for managing layers. The worldwind java version was awarded nasa software of the year in november 2009. For a list of plugins compatible with world wind 1. It is now developed by nasa staff and open source community developers. World wind central has a full alphabetical list of addons for nasa world wind.
422 1519 1120 1038 1402 1511 1107 1293 541 894 549 428 1571 400 917 560 1603 97 660 1000 1255 635 1015 787 332 435 825 749 1446 1249 494 132